George Clooney "hurt" to know that the Royal Baby wasn't named after him

Royals Prince Harry and Meghan Markle revealed the name of their baby boy, Archie Harrison

Mountbatten-Windsor

, on Wednesday. While the world gushes over the news, George Clooney can't help feeling a little slighted that they didn't name it in his honor.

Speaking at an event for his new show, Clooney was asked how he felt that they didn't include the name George in their baby's moniker at all. "That kind of hurts," Clooney said, before laughing and admitted, "I like it! Archie. It's good!"

The baby's middle name could also be inspired from actor Harrison Ford, the star said that he understood the choice if that's the case. "Well, he was president in a movie, once," Clooney reasoned with a shrug, before admitting his own reverence for the '

Star Wars

' icon. "And, if you think about it, it is Harrison Ford. I'm gonna [re]name my daughter Harrison now."

Clooney was speaking at the premiere of his show in Hollywood, one day after the royal baby's birth, which happened to be Clooney's 58th birthday, and the actor joked that the Royal Baby "is stealing my thunder!"

"This was my day! I was sharing it already with Orson Welles and Sigmund Freud!" Clooney quipped.

Despite having two children of his own, Clooney said that he doesn't feel it's his place to give the Duke and Duchess, or anyone else for that matter, advice on anything. "I don't give advice, I'm 58," he said. "At 58 you just go, 'Ugggh.' I just walk with a walker everywhere I go."
